IIRC, Origin scans and records data on your entire PC rather than just EA games. Their EULA also allows them to revoke digital rights if your account is inactive for two years. It's the most bullshit DRM I know of. Granted, I still use it for free games and a couple of sales on EA-only games (I got the C&C collection and Medal of Honor: Allied Assault for cheap, and a friend sent me Mass Effect Trilogy). I avoid it like the plague if there are any other options available to me. I MUCH prefer Steam. Battle.net isn't bad, and I don't mind Uplay that much, but I'm not a big fan of their interface.
